| I'm looking for a specific delay plug in. Hey guys. In Pro Tools I usually send the delay (Extra Long Delay II) back into itself with an eq after it so everytime it delays, it becomes more and more filtered (continually changes over time). Is there a delay plug in that does this on it's own without having to send it to itself?
